A carefully composed floral wrist corsage is displayed along the inner forearm and hand against a pristine white background; the visible skin is a warm, light-to-medium brown that complements the arrangement's soft tones. Dominating the design is a large, open rose in a pale peach or champagne-apricot shade, its many velvety petals curled delicately toward the centre and catching the light to reveal subtle tonal shifts. Nestled beneath and to one side are two vivid lime-green button chrysanthemums-compact, almost spherical clusters that inject a spirited, textural contrast to the rose's smooth volutes. The flowers are cradled by rich, glossy foliage: broad dark-green leaves (likely ruscus or salal) provide depth and structure, while an artful variegated leaf, striped in lighter green and cream, has been folded into a refined, architectural curl that sweeps across the wrist area and adds a contemporary edge. The arrangement feels freshly made-the leaf edges taut, the petals uncompromised-and although the means of attachment is not shown, a discreet elastic or ribbon can be imagined keeping the corsage snug and comfortable. Bring a warm, romantic glow to your wedding party with the Sun Kissed Wedding Corsage from Flowers Raynes Park. Featuring a delicate blend of pale orange roses and fresh green chrysanthemum, this premium corsage set offers a soft, sunlit finish that beautifully complements both classic and contemporary bridal looks. Perfect for brides, bridesmaids and special guests, each corsage is thoughtfully arranged to feel elegant yet natural, adding a refined pop of colour to dresses, suits or wristbands.

Handcrafted in Raynes Park by experienced florists, these corsages are designed for comfort and all-day wear, using fresh, long-lasting blooms that photograph beautifully. The subtle peachy-orange tones pair effortlessly with ivory, blush, sage and champagne wedding palettes, making styling simple for your entire entourage.

Price is for a set of four corsages, ideal for coordinating your bridal party with one easy order.
